草庐IT

多对多

全部标签

python - 使用 flask reSTLess 的多对多关系,发布一对多数据

我的问题是如何使用post添加多对多关系数据我正在使用flask、flask-SQLAlchemy、flask-reSTLess和angularjs、json我有一些这样的表classPage(db.Model):id=db.Column(db.Integer,primary_key=True)page_name=db.Column(db.String(10))classTag(db.Model):id=db.Column(db.Integer,primary_key=True)tag_name=db.Column(db.String(10))classPageTags(db.Mode

python - 具有不同序列长度的多对多序列预测

我的问题是预测值序列(t_0,t_1,...t_{n_post-1})给定之前的时间步(t_{-n_pre},t_{-n_pre+1}...t_{-1})使用Keras的LSTM层。Keras很好地支持以下两种情况:n_post==1(多对一预测)n_post==n_pre(多对多预测具有相同的序列长度)但不是n_post所在的版本.为了说明我的需要,我使用正弦波构建了一个简单的玩具示例。多对一模型预测使用以下模型:model=Sequential()model.add(LSTM(input_dim=1,output_dim=hidden_neurons,return_sequence

python - 如何按字母顺序对多对多 django-admin 框中的值进行排序?

我有一个像这样的简单模型:classArtist(models.Model):surname=models.CharField(max_length=200)name=models.CharField(max_length=200,blank=True)slug=models.SlugField(unique=True)photo=models.ImageField(upload_to='artists',blank=True)bio=models.TextField(blank=True)classImages(models.Model):title=models.CharField

python - Django 过滤对象至少有一个多对多属性值

我正在寻找使用Django的ORM做一个复杂的过滤器。模型:classBook(models.Model):title=models.TextField()bestseller=models.BooleanField(default=False)classAuthor(models.Model):name=models.TextField()books=models.ManytoManyField(Book)我如何查询至少拥有一本畅销书的所有作者?查询:best_authors=Author.objects.filter()编辑:根据documentation,以下应该有效:best_

python - Django/Python - 通过多对多关系中的公共(public)集对对象进行分组

这部分是算法逻辑问题(如何做),部分是实现问题(如何做到最好!)。我正在使用Django,所以我想我会分享一下。在Python中,值得一提的是这个问题与how-do-i-use-pythons-itertoolsgroupby有点相关。.假设您有两个Django模型派生类:fromdjango.dbimportmodelsclassCar(models.Model):mods=models.ManyToManyField(Representative)和fromdjango.dbimportmodelsclassMods(models.Model):...如何获得按具有一组通用Mod的

python - NLTK/NLP 构建多对多/多标签主题分类器

我有一个人工标记的语料库,其中包含5000多个XML主题索引文档。它们的大小从几百千字节到几百兆字节不等。短文转手稿。它们都被索引到了段落级别。我很幸运有这样的语料库,我正在尝试自学一些NLP概念。诚然,我才刚刚开始。到目前为止,只阅读了免费提供的NLTK书籍,streamhacker,并略读jacobs(?)NLTK食谱。我喜欢尝试一些想法。有人向我建议,也许我可以采用二元语法并使用朴素贝叶斯分类来标记新文档。我觉得这是错误的做法。朴素贝叶斯精通真/假关系,但要在我的分层标签集上使用它,我需要为每个标签构建一个新的分类器。其中将近1000个。我有足够的内存和处理器能力来完成这样的任务

python - 如何使用 WTForms 和 SQLAlchemy 更新多对多数据?

我在使用FlaskFramework构建应用程序时遇到了一个小问题。我正在尝试创建一个简单的用户+权限模块。为了存档它,我在Users和Permissions表之间建立了多对多关系。这是我的模型、形式和路线型号user_perm=db.Table('user_perm',db.Column('user_id',db.Integer,db.ForeignKey('user.id')),db.Column('perm_id',db.Integer,db.ForeignKey('permissions.id')))classUser(db.Model):__tablename__='user

python - 扁平化Django中的一对多关系

我有几个具有基本一对多关系的模型类。比如一本书有很多菜谱,每个菜谱有很多配料:classBook(models.Model):name=models.CharField(max_length=64)classRecipe(models.Model):book=models.ForeignKey(Book)name=models.CharField(max_length=64)classIngredient(models.Model):text=models.CharField(max_length=128)recipe=models.ForeignKey(Recipe)我想要一份特定书

python - Django 中的多对一字段

我试图在“多”类中定义一个多对一字段。例如,假设一个用户只能是一个组的成员,但一个组可以有很多用户:classUser(models.Model):name=models.CharField()classGroup(models.Model):name=models.CharField()#ThisiswhatIwanttodo->users=models.ManyToOneField(User)Django文档会告诉我在用户模型中定义一个组字段作为外键,但我需要在组模型中定义关系。据我所知,没有ManyToOneField,我宁愿不必使用ManyToManyField。

python - 在 Django Admin 中订购多对多字段

这是我的设置:fromdjango.contrib.auth.modelsimportUserclassProduct(models.Model):...email_users=models.ManyToManyField(User,null=True,blank=True)...[别处]classProductAdmin(admin.ModelAdmin):list_display=('name','platform')admin.site.register(Product,ProductAdmin)我的主要问题是,当我在管理部分查看“产品”页面时,默认情况下电子邮件用户不会按他们的